The city was burning.
Ash fell from the heavens like snow.
Women and children pleaded for their husbands and fathers who would never return.
Sky scrappers had been reduced to dust.
Cars hung off buildings like coats on a hanger.
And all the while, he stood there.
He watched.
He had watched it all.
He tried to help, he tried to be a hero.
But alas it was in vain, for he was no hero.
The beast, the monster was too strong.
Its rage too powerful.
Or maybe it was that he was too weak.
He fought with all his little might.
He screamed, he begged it to stop.
But it couldn't.
It wouldn't.
So he watched.
He watched himself transform.
He watched as his body morphed into the unholy beast he really was.
The freak.
The monster.
He watched as he destroyed that city.
And just as the heavens had cried with ash upon that still burning city.
He cried tears of pain along with it.
He was the monster.
The monster was man.
